    Thankyou so much - I honestly wish I'd let them all default before starting our dmp as I'd never missed a payment so started it straight away. If I'd seen the advice on here I wild auvergne let them all default 1st as that would have started the clock of them being on our credit file for 6 years at the very beginning.  Whereas some of ours only defaulted after a year or 2. 
    I'd probably be gett8ng some offers in by now too.
    I did start banking with someone we didn't have debts with straight away so am grateful that I knew that.

    • Checking in to say that from 18 creditors and 42k in 2022 on a dmp with SC we are now at 12 creditors and 22k.
    We sent off cca requests in March.
    N*xt couldn't find theirs yet so we aren't paying that for now.
    Lowell said they'd be in touch whe  found so same.
    Hsbc, natwest, very came back with cca agreements so we are paying those.
    The remaining accounts are with link and just not satisfied that their responses complied eg wrong address on one etc.
    Letters sent to say please put on hold until able to comply amd send the correct info. 
    Sc have been helpful and take  the money for those and put them on hold for 6 weeks and will reassess at that time whether the money goes to them or to the other creditors.
    So it's been a slog but we've redone our budget and paying £50 a month less for now.
    I wish I'd asked for cca agreements earlier to know where we stood with what is and isn't enforceable
    We may get all the agreements back but we shall see.
    Once they are all ironed put planning to self manage
    Pay the enforceable ones and try and build a pit for full and finals and chip away.
    With hindsight I wish we had defaulted on everything before starting with sc, built up an emergency fund and got all of the Defaults out of the way. Also then be in a better postion for full and finals and get some.discpunt possibly.
    Now in a position where some haven't even defaulted and don't really want them to 3 years down the line so If you are reading this please take the good advice given by some of the people who reply and maybe do this even if it feels counter intuitive.

    Now in a position where some haven't even defaulted and don't really want them to 3 years down the line
    Unless you will clear them in the next couple of years, you still want these defaulted now. Is annoying it wasnt 2 years ago, but dont let that stop you making the right decision now.

    No! You shouldn't feel bad, you should be feeling very pleased with yourself!

    One "trick" you should do every year is review your payments to the leeches. You need to update your SOA that you might share, bearing in mind that living costs are outstripping inflation by some margin.

    This should mean that the amount that you have spare for repayments will decrease (quite considerably) each year. Your creditors know this and none of mine have ever questioned it.

    You need to make sure that you are reducing the amounts you pay to creditors to compensate for this ( and to allow you to put more in your fighting fund).
